A Painful Bliss

A Painful Bliss

She arrives
As the last scarlet page
Falls and leaves her poet's cage.
I watch her
Coming down the aisle,
Gracefully, elegantly, tenderly,
Clad in white,
Incandescently bright,
She crawls along this heavy hour
And devours
With insatiable thirst
Colors and sounds and dyes in haste.
My naked neck is bruised and blue,
My body numb, motionless.
For she bites
With her frosty lips.
I coil and curl, and close my eyes,
And give my being to
her arctic breath,
I am defenseless to her kiss,
To this
Birth in death,
To this painful bliss.

She is lovely, cold and bleak
And I have no promise to keep
Only want a lasting sleep
Amidst her timeless boundless deep.
